Skip Navigation Website Accessibility

search our store

SHIPPING + RETURNS


SHIPPING RATES
We do our best to keep our shipping rates low despite constantly rising costs. Your shipping includes packaging and handling fees, and you will receive a tracking number once it has shipped.


US orders over $150: FREE!
All other countries: invoiced after your order is placed

Invoiced international orders are charged for actual shipping costs via a separate invoice once we have received your order and packaged it up. Your order will ship out as soon as we receive payment on the shopping invoice. Packages 4 lbs and under will ship via USPS First Class, and 4 lbs and over will ship USPS Priority or via UPS if that option is more cost efficient. You will receive a tracking number once your order has shipped. If you have any questions or would like an estimate of shipping before placing your order, please email us at info@esthersfabrics.com.

PICKUP IN STORE AND CURBSIDE PICKUP
Curbside pickup is available outside of our store for free. Please select the Pickup Option after you enter your shipping address. Curbside pickup is available only for local residents.

RETURNS
We want our customers to be happy. We will make every effort to make sure you are satisfied with your purchase, but if for any reason you are unsatisfied, please email us and let us know at info@esthersfabrics.com. If you receive the wrong item, you are missing an item, or something was damaged, please let us know within 72 hours of receiving your package and we will make your order right.

If you are unsatisfied with your fabric, notion, or kit purchase for any reason, we will accept a return for store credit or exchange within 30 days of date of original purchase. Fabric, kits and notions must be in original condition. Fabric must not have been washed, and kits and notions must be in their original packaging. We will issue your digital gift card once we receive the item back for the price of the goods. Unfortunately, we cannot refund your shipping costs or cover the cost of shipping a return to us. We cannot accept returns on any patterns, or sale items. These are final sale and may not be returned. For any returned merchandise, please be sure to include your order number, email address and phone number so that we can process your return faster.

For exchanges, you are responsible for shipping costs to send the exchange back to us, and we will cover the shipping cost of sending a new item back for one time only. Please notify us at info@esthersfabrics.com that you are sending an exchange and what you would like in return, and we will set the new items aside for you until the exchange is received.

Contact Us

  • Esther's Fabrics
    181 Winslow Way E Suite D
    Bainbridge Island, WA 98110
    Call us now: 206-842-2261
    Email: info@esthersfabrics.com
Logo